What to consider before buying

Consider your dog's size, your vehicle's interior dimensions, and installation ease. For small dogs, a lightweight shock-cord barrier may suffice; for large dogs, opt for a heavy-duty steel or aluminum barrier. Also check if the barrier has a pass-through door for convenience.
